Big Bang Theory To End: What Is Coming Next

Final Season Details and Broadcast Plan

The series finale of The Big Bang Theory aired in May 2019, concluding the twelfth season. The final season consisted of 24 episodes, bringing the total episode count to 279. The finale drew 18.52 million viewers in the United States, making it the most-watched episode of the season. CBS announced the final season order in January 2017, confirming the show would conclude after season 12. CBS aired the series across multiple time slots during its run, with the final episodes airing on Thursday nights.

The show was produced by Chuck Lorre Productions and Warner Bros. Television. The finale wrapped storylines for the main characters, including Sheldon and Amy's wedding and Howard and Bernadette's family life. The series finale was written by series creators Chuck Lorre and Bill Prady, and directed by Mark Cendrowski. The episode title was "The Stockholm Syndrome."

Main Cast Earnings and Contracts

In the final seasons, the six lead actors earned a reported 1 million per episode each. This made them among the highest-paid television actors at the time. The main cast includes Jim Parsons, Johnny Galecki, Kaley Cuoco, Simon Helberg, Kunal Nayyar, and Melissa Rauch. Forbes reported that the cast negotiated raises multiple times during the show's run, with their total earnings from the series exceeding 1 billion.

The actors also received backend participation in the show's syndication and streaming profits. Warner Bros. Television distributed the series globally, with reruns airing in over 200 countries. What Comes Next After The Big Bang Theory

Several spin-offs and related projects have been announced or are in development. The most notable is a prequel series focused on the young Sheldon Cooper, titled Young Sheldon, which aired from 2017 to 2024 on CBS. Warner Bros. has also explored additional spinoff concepts, though none have been confirmed as series orders yet. The main cast members have pursued other projects, with Jim Parsons starring in new series and Kaley Cuoco producing and acting in other roles.

The Big Bang Theory remains one of the highest-rated sitcoms in television history, with a consistent top 10 Nielsen ranking for most of its run. The show's finale set a record for the largest audience for a sitcom finale in the 2010s.
